What are ICA files?
ICA files are associated with IOCA (Image Object Content Architecture), a graphics format used by some archaic IBM computer models. ICA images often contain scanned images, which can be black-and-white, grayscale or colored. The ICA format is currently considered obsolete and rare, so converting it to a more accessible format might be the best option.
What are TGA files?
The TGA (Truevision Graphics Adapter) format, also known as Truevision TGA or TARGA, is a bitmap file containing raster graphics and was initially associated with TARGA and VISTA boards. TGA files can be used on DOS, Windows and Mac OS X platforms for storing and transferring deep-pixel images. They support a color range of up to 24 bits and an 8-bit alpha channel. TGA files are associated with graphic adapters that can capture NTSC and/or PAL video images signals, and they are particularly popular in the domain of still-video editing.
